Analisis Keterlaksanaan Pembelajaran Biologi pada Kurikulum Merdeka di SMA Negeri Kota Padang Putri, Nur Aisyah; Lufri; Syamsurizal; Arsih, Fitri; Fajrina, Suci

Abstract

The Merdeka Curriculum is a curriculum policy that provides schools the freedom to develop a curriculum according to the needs and learning environment of the students. This curriculum, which has been in place for the past three years, must be evaluated on a micro level. This study aims to reveal the implementation of biology learning in the Merdeka Curriculum at State High Schools in Padang City. A survey method using a questionnaire instrument consisting of 70 statements regarding lesson planning, learning implementation, learning assessment, the Pancasila student profile, and learning obstacles was used to collect data. The research sample consisted of 34 biology teachers and 100 students at State High Schools in Padang City. The results showed that the aspect of lesson planning scored 78.78% in the good category, the aspect of learning implementation scored 80.82% in the good category, the element of learning assessment scored 79.26% in the good category, the aspect of the Pancasila student profile scored 78.04% in the good category, and learning obstacles scored 43.06% in the small category. Overall, the implementation of biology learning in the Merdeka Curriculum at State High Schools in Padang is in a good category with minor obstacles.

Diversity Biological Food in the Yards of the Skouw Village Community Muara Tami District Lainsamputty, Judith; Antoh, Alfred A.; Rumahorbo, Basa T.

Abstract

This research aims to analyze the value of the diversity of plant types in the yards of the people of Skouw Sae village, Muara Tami District, Jayapura City. Research data collection was carried out by surveying and analyzing yard plant vegetation. Biodiversity data were analyzed using PAST (Paleontological Statistics) software version 4.09. Analysis of yard plant vegetation in the people of Skouw Sae village, Muara Tami District, Jayapura City was obtained from 20 house yards and obtained 27 plant species which were distributed at almost all stations or planted in people's houses. There are 5 strata of food plant vegetation in people's yards with varying numbers of individuals. The first stratum consisted of 895 individuals, the second stratum 32 individuals, the third stratum 122 individuals, the fourth stratum 281 individuals, and the fifth stratum 570 individuals. If we look at the number of strata species, it is found that the first stratum consists of 12 species, the second stratum is 5 species, the third stratum is 10 species, the fourth stratum is 11 species, and the fifth stratum is 9 species. Overall, the diversity of food plants found in the yards of the people of Skouw Sae village can be categorized as moderate (H'= 1.49).
Bagaimana E-book “Chemistry Challenge” Mempengaruhi Profil Literasi Bahan Kimia? Kajian untuk Menguji Efektivitas Media Pembelajaran Pratama, Faiz Ilham; Rohaeti, Eli

Abstract

The appropriate utilization of media can greatly impact one's chemical literacy. A prior study involved the development of an e-book called "Chemistry Challenge," which is specifically in chemical equilibrium. This research aims to evaluate the chemical literacy profile of students who have utilized the "Chemistry Challenge" e-book and determine if there are significant differences between those who have used it and those who have not. The Chemical Equilibrium Literacy Questionnaire (CELQ) was utilized as an instrument for data collection. The CELQ data was analyzed utilizing ideal criteria assessment to evaluate the chemical literacy profile, and the independent t-test was used to see significant differences. The results of the CELQ show that 82% of students have a chemistry literacy profile in the good and very good categories after using the "Chemistry Challenge" e-book, this result is superior to students who learn using student worksheets. Apart from that, statistically, there are significant differences between the two groups of students. Therefore, the use of the "Chemistry Challenge" e-book has a positive effect on students' chemical literacy profiles.
